Output 246167de4be4fdb688906fa19bd16b0306993bcfbd2c56bf8df9cf66d9a9f742:0

value
5243963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ab7bbfee8728231cde7b7ecedb5bc4cb7624632 OP_EQUAL
address
3CstU2vvQW5BgR7LMz9hvC6cffnFUKXjde
transaction
246167de4be4fdb688906fa19bd16b0306993bcfbd2c56bf8df9cf66d9a9f742
spent
true